codex Prompt:
第一步:让它先理解
请先分析当前项目结构:
1. 核心模块
2. 调用链
3. 数据流
4. 数据库设计
5. 潜在风险
先不要修改代码。
第二步:让它给方案
基于当前架构,
设计 MQTT ACL 权限方案:
要求:
1. 多租户隔离
2. Redis 缓存
3. 动态刷新
4. 支持 topic wildcard
先输出设计方案和目录结构。
不要修改代码。
第三步:再让它动手
按照上面的方案,
分步骤实施。
先完成:
1. ACL 数据结构
2. Redis 缓存层
3. Topic 匹配器
不要修改业务逻辑。
本文为原创内容,作者:闲鹤,原文链接:https://blog.uwenya.cc/1669.html,转载请注明出处。